🔥 Neuvillette's Optimal Artifact Build
Since Neuvillette thrives as a primary damage dealer, your primary focus should be maximizing his CRIT potential while managing his unique HP-draining mechanics. His charged attack consumes HP, creating a dynamic playstyle that rewards strategic artifact choices.
The Undisputed Champion: Marechaussee Hunter (4-Set)

This artifact set is practically tailor-made for Neuvillette's kit:
-
2-Set Bonus: Increases Normal and Charged Attack DMG by 15%
-
4-Set Bonus: When current HP increases or decreases, CRIT Rate increases by 12% for 5 seconds (max 3 stacks)
Why it's perfect: Neuvillette's charged attack naturally drains his HP, which triggers the Marechaussee Hunter's 4-set effect, granting him up to 36% CRIT Rate! This symbiotic relationship turns his supposed weakness into a tremendous strength. 🎯
